Phoenix Labs To Change Dauntless Development Focus To Address Player Feedback
The Dauntless team has been doing a pretty decent job of updating the game on a regular basis. Every other week, the game recieved fixes and improvements as well as general updates. Now, the team has decided to shift focus a bit. For the upcoming December update they've decided to work on addressing all the player feedback they've received.
Between now and December, Phoenix Labs will roll out weekly updates and previews as an introduction to the "Sharpen Your Skills" Update. The first is already here -- a progression update that players can read about on the game's site. In addition, they can look forward to the following:
- A brand new weapon preview, enhancements to damage systems, and other combat updates
- Two new Behemoth reveals
- An equipment augmentation system that will change the way you play and craft
The Dauntless Roadmap is being updated to reflect the upcoming changes. You can check it on on the game's site as well.
